Ticket: Staging env misconfigured for Siftgate bloom filter

The bloom layer in front of the Pellet KV store is rejecting all lookups in staging because the env file was copied from the dev template without credentials. False-positive tuning values are fine; only the auth line is missing. To unblock the weekly demo, the Pellet admission secret must be set on the following line.

env line for yaguf-fajop: LEDGER_TOKEN13=fb08984397349

Handover — blueprint set, Garnet Quay project

To the driver's coordinator: full blueprint set for the Garnet Quay permit application is in the grey tube, sealed, left with reception at the Windrow Street office. Originals only — no copies made. Needs to reach the Calderfield planning office before Friday noon or the submission window closes. Tube stays sealed in transit. Hand-over instruction is below.

dispatch memo: the eliok quenok courier leaves the sorael aldath belion tammir casix gileth queniel jorath ledger at gate 9299 under passcode 897989

The Keymolt utility rotates secrets for internal services on a fixed schedule, writing each new credential to the vault, verifying a test call succeeds, and only then revoking the predecessor. Failures roll back automatically and page the owning team. Rotation runs are idempotent and logged end to end. For this week's demo, Keymolt authenticates to the staging vault with the key below.

gateway credential: kto23_LX9A4ys6i4nzHtpOLNLodKK

Break-glass access: SquatWatch

Quick notes for the weekly sync. SquatWatch is our typo-squatting package scanner; if it goes dark, malicious lookalike packages can slip into the Pellbrook registry, so we keep a break-glass path. Use it only when both regular admins are unreachable and the scanner has been down 30+ minutes. Grab the sealed envelope from the ops locker, log the incident in #squatwatch-alerts, and ping whoever's on call. The break-glass login prompts for the passphrase below.

unlock words, tagaf-tawif: quenys-zordor-aldius-caswyn

Break-Glass Access — Rendersmith Perf Tools

Scope: emergency access to the Rendersmith template-rendering profiler in prod. Use only when render latency exceeds SLO and the normal grant flow is down. Access is logged and auto-revoked after two hours. Reviewers: flag any PR that widens this scope. To activate break-glass, run the unlock script and enter the passphrase below.

unlock words, hahip-yagef: zorok-novmir-zorix-silax